The Rise of Aluminium Windows and Doors: A Comprehensive Overview

In the world of modern architecture and design, the products chosen for windows and doors play a critical function in improving both aesthetic appeal and functionality. One material that has acquired considerable traction over current years is aluminium. Known for its toughness, adaptability, and streamlined appearance, aluminium is ending up being a go-to option for property owners and contractors alike. This article digs into the advantages, factors to consider, and market patterns connected to aluminium doors and windows, while also addressing some often asked concerns.

Benefits of Aluminium Windows and Doors

Aluminium windows and doors provide a huge selection of advantages that have added to their increasing appeal. Below are some crucial advantages:

1. Durability

  • Weather Resistance: Aluminium is naturally resistant to the components, consisting of rain, snow, and UV radiation. This resistance makes sure that doors and windows keep their structural stability over time.
  • Long Lifespan: Unlike wood, aluminium does not rot, warp, or require frequent painting. This durability equates to reduce upkeep expenses.

2. Lightweight yet Strong

  • Higher Strength-to-Weight Ratio: Aluminium is substantially lighter than materials like steel, enabling larger window designs without compromising structural stability.
  • Custom Size Options: The lightweight nature enables simple installation, even in bigger configurations.

3. Visual Versatility

  • Modern Appearance: The smooth lines of aluminium frames supply a contemporary aesthetic that matches various architectural designs.
  • Varied Finishes: Aluminium can be powder-coated or anodized, using a wide variety of colors and surfaces to match personal tastes and the total design scheme.

4. Energy Efficiency

  • Thermal Break Technology: Aluminium frames can incorporate thermal breaks, which enhance insulation and energy performance by reducing heat transfer.
  • Glazing Options: Pairing aluminium with energy-efficient double or triple glazing helps in maintaining indoor temperature level, resulting in minimized cooling and heating expenses.

5. Security

  • Improved Security Features: Aluminium frames can be designed to accommodate multi-point locking systems, offering greater security than standard alternatives.

6. Low Maintenance

  • Easy Upkeep: Regular cleansing with soap and water is usually all that aluminium frames need, making them a perfect option for hectic homeowners.

7. Sustainability

  • Recyclability: Aluminium is 100% recyclable without loss of homes, making it an eco-friendly alternative for mindful customers.

Factors To Consider When Choosing Aluminium Windows and Doors

While there are numerous advantages, it's important for potential buyers to think about the following factors:

1. Initial Cost

  • Aluminium doors and windows generally have a higher upfront expense compared to vinyl options. However, their long-lasting toughness can offset these initial expenses.

2. Condensation Issues

  • Without proper thermal breaks, aluminium can be prone to condensation, which might lead to moisture problems. Quality products need to address this issue through advanced styles.

3. Limited Design Flexibility

  • While aluminium uses numerous personalizing options, some particular architectural styles might be less feasible compared to materials like wood.

Selecting the Right Aluminium Windows and Doors

When choosing aluminium doors and windows, it's important to think about numerous aspects to guarantee that the financial investment lines up with one's needs.

Key Factors to Consider:

  • Style and Functionality: Determine what designs (e.g., sash, sliding, bifold) and functionalities are needed based on the space.
  • Quality and Performance: Look for items that supply thorough thermal and weather condition efficiency ratings.
  • Manufacturer Reputation: Choose reliable manufacturers known for their quality and customer care.
  • Warranty: A robust warranty can safeguard versus future issues, making it a critical aspect of the buying decision.

Market Trends in Aluminium Windows and Doors

The demand for aluminium doors and windows is rising due to evolving architectural trends and customer choices. Some notable market trends include:

  1. Integration with Smart Technology: Smart home integration is becoming popular, with functions such as automated opening/closing and security alerts.
  2. Energy-efficient Products: Increased awareness of environment change has led consumers to choose energy-efficient choices, further driving the demand for thermally broken aluminium items.
  3. Hybrid Designs: The progressing pattern of integrating materials, such as blending aluminium exteriors with wooden interiors for aesthetic appeal, is making headway.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Are aluminium windows pricey?

While the preliminary cost of aluminium windows is higher than vinyl, their resilience and low maintenance needs typically make them a more economical option over time.

2. How frequently should aluminium windows be cleaned up?

Regular cleansing with soap and water is recommended, around once every 6 months, to keep them looking good and functioning properly.

3. Can aluminium windows And doors aluminium and doors be painted?

Aluminium frames typically come in pre-finished colors, but if alterations are necessary, specific paint developed for metals can be utilized for touch-ups.

4. Do all aluminium windows include thermal insulation?

Not all; for that reason, it is recommended to inquire about thermal break technology when choosing your aluminium doors and windows.

5. Are aluminium windows recyclable?

Yes, aluminium is highly recyclable, making it a sustainable choice for eco-conscious consumers.
